Jimmy Fallon utilized an impressive iPad setup on The Tonight Show last night to sing a duet with Billy Joel in a cappella of the classic song The Lion Sleeps Tonight by The Tokens.
AppleInsider points out how Fallon’s iPad mini setup as revealed by a member of the Tonight Show staff on Twitter. The Apogee Quartet retails for $1,395 CDN and allowed wireless microphones to be connected to the iPad mini, which was running the $7.99 app Loopy HD:
“Tonight” staff member John MacDonald revealed on Friday that Fallon’s iPad mini was connected to an Apogee Quartet. The setup put together by Grammy winning producer Lawrence Manchester, who is a music mixer for Fallon’s program, made it possible for microphones to be connected to the iPad and Loopy HD.
